One of the most vital elements of managing door locks is handling keys effectively.
Produce a Key Inventory: Keep track of all keys and their corresponding locks to prevent confusion.Use Key Tags: Label secrets for simple recognition.Limitation Number of Copies: Only duplicate keys when necessary, and limitation access to duplicates.2. Lock Installation

Regular maintenance is important for keeping locks in excellent working condition.
Lubricate Locks: Apply graphite lube to minimize friction and ensure smooth operation.Inspect for Wear and Tear: Regularly check locks for indications of damage or wear.Test Keys: Frequently test keys to guarantee they run smoothly without resistance.4. Troubleshooting Common Issues

It's recommended to lube your door locks a minimum of once a year or more regularly if you discover tightness in operation.
Can I install a door lock myself?
Yes, with the right tools and following producer instructions, lots of door locks replacement locks can be installed by homeowners. Nevertheless, if in doubt, hiring an expert locksmith is advised.
What should I do if my key breaks off in the lock?
If a crucial breaks off in the lock, prevent trying to extract it yourself as this could damage the lock. Rather, seek the help of a locksmith.
Are smart locks more secure than conventional locks?
Smart locks can offer boosted security features, such as remote access and alerts, but they also count on batteries and internet connectivity. The security level ultimately depends on the specific item and installation.
How do I know when to change a lock?
Indications that a lock requirements replacement include trouble in turning the secret, noticeable damage, or having been compromised. If in doubt, seek advice from a locksmith.
